ttrss/themes/light/prefs.less

293 lines
4.0 KiB
Plaintext
Raw Normal View History

2017-12-03 09:49:40 +00:00
body.ttrss_prefs {
background-color : @color-panel-bg;
font-family: "Helvetica Neue", Helvetica, Arial, sans-serif;
2018-12-04 17:17:50 +00:00
font-size: 14px;
h1, h2, h3, h4 {
font-family : @fonts-ui-bold;
font-weight : 600;
color : @default-text;
}
2021-03-05 12:16:41 +00:00
.dijitContentPane {
> h1:first-of-type,
> h2:first-of-type,
> h3:first-of-type {
margin-top: 0;
}
2021-03-05 12:16:41 +00:00
}
#footer, #header {
padding : 8px;
font-size : 13px;
}
#header {
float : right;
}
#footer_splitter {
display : none;
}
#footer {
background-color : @color-panel-bg;
font-size : 13px;
border : 0px;
text-align : center;
}
#header img {
vertical-align : middle;
cursor : pointer;
}
2018-12-04 17:17:50 +00:00
.dijitTree#filterTree .dijitTreeIcon,
.dijitTree#labelTree .dijitTreeIcon,
.dijitTree#filterTree .dijitTreeIcon {
display : none;
}
.dijitAccordionTitle i.material-icons {
top : -1px;
position : relative;
}
.dijitAccordionTitleSelected i.material-icons {
color : white;
}
#feedsTab {
background : @color-panel-bg;
}
.dijitDialog #pref-profiles-list .dijitInlineEditBoxDisplayMode {
padding : 0px;
}
2021-02-13 20:12:49 +00:00
#pref_feeds_errors_btn {
color : red;
}
.user-css-editor {
height : 300px;
width : 575px;
}
2019-02-25 16:22:20 +00:00
fieldset.prefs {
min-height : 30px;
display : flex;
flex-direction : row;
align-items: center;
2019-02-25 14:15:05 +00:00
label:first-of-type {
min-width : 300px;
}
.help-text {
display : inline-block;
margin-left : 10px;
}
.help-text-bottom {
margin-top : 10px;
}
}
fieldset.plugin {
label.description {
2021-03-04 13:44:21 +00:00
width : 550px;
2019-02-25 16:11:17 +00:00
margin-right : 150px;
2019-02-25 14:15:05 +00:00
display : inline-block;
2019-02-25 14:15:05 +00:00
.dijitCheckBox {
margin-right : 10px;
}
2018-12-05 13:37:09 +00:00
}
}
table {
th {
text-align : left;
}
td.checkbox {
text-align : center;
width : 32px;
2021-02-06 13:24:40 +00:00
}
2021-02-06 13:24:40 +00:00
}
2021-03-06 15:14:25 +00:00
ul.prefs-plugin-list {
margin : 0;
padding : 0;
li {
display : flex;
align-items : center;
border-bottom: @border-default 1px solid;
2021-03-06 17:28:10 +00:00
line-height : 30px;
&.text-center {
border : 0;
display : block;
}
2021-03-06 15:14:25 +00:00
> * {
padding : 8px;
2021-03-06 15:14:25 +00:00
}
label.checkbox {
display : flex;
align-items : center;
min-width : 300px;
2021-03-06 15:14:25 +00:00
cursor : pointer;
&.system {
cursor : auto;
}
.name {
flex-grow: 2;
display: inline-block;
text-align: right;
font-weight : bold;
}
}
.actions {
flex-grow : 2;
text-align: right;
}
.version {
min-width: 200px;
text-align: right;
}
}
}
.plugin-installer-list, .plugin-updater-list {
li {
border-bottom: @border-default 1px solid;
> * {
padding : 8px 4px;
}
> pre {
margin : 0;
}
h3 {
margin : 0;
}
&.text-center {
border : 0;
}
}
.plugin-installed > * {
opacity : 0.5;
}
}
.users-list,
.event-log {
td, th {
cursor : pointer;
padding : 8px;
border-bottom: @border-default 1px solid;
}
}
2021-02-06 13:11:29 +00:00
.event-log {
tr {
td, th {
2021-02-06 13:11:29 +00:00
vertical-align : top;
}
.errno {
font-style : italic;
font-weight : bold;
white-space : nowrap;
}
.errstr {
2021-02-06 13:11:29 +00:00
word-break : break-all;
white-space : pre-wrap;
}
.filename, .login, .timestamp {
color : @default-text;
}
}
}
hr {
border-color : @border-default;
max-width : 100%;
}
2019-02-20 05:51:48 +00:00
.phpinfo {
table {
border-collapse : collapse;
}
td.e, td.v {
border : 1px solid #ccc;
}
td.e {
font-weight : bold;
}
td.v {
font-family : monospace;
2019-03-04 06:05:34 +00:00
word-break : break-all;
2019-02-20 05:51:48 +00:00
}
}
}
body.ttrss_prefs,
body.ttrss_main {
#filterNewRuleDlg {
.dijitValidationTextAreaError {
background : #ffc0c0;
}
.dijitValidationTextArea:not(.dijitValidationTextAreaError) {
background : #c0ffc0;
}
}
}
body.ttrss_prefs,
body.ttrss_utility {
fieldset {
border-width : 0px;
padding : 5px 0px;
}
fieldset.narrow {
padding : 2px 0px;
}
fieldset.align-right {
text-align : right;
}
fieldset > label:first-of-type {
min-width : 140px;
margin-right : 20px;
display : inline-block;
text-align : right;
font-weight : bold;
}
fieldset > label.checkbox {
display : inline;
font-weight : normal;
}
}